Effectiveness of a Customized Digital Platform to Increase Coordination of Care and Uptake of Evidence-based Practices: a Protocol for a Stepped-wedge Cluster Randomized Trial in Quebec

Background: Cardiovascular and neurological conditions are major causes of disability worldwide. Early, intensive rehabilitation is essential but often challenging to access in current healthcare systems. In Canada, the direct and indirect costs of acquired brain injury (ABI) are substantial, emphasizing the need for improved rehabilitation services. In collaboration with four health regions and the Canadian Foundation of Innovation (CFI) funded BRILLIANT research group, investigators are implementing a digital health platform (the BRILLIANT platform), which includes five modules to address current gaps and support a person-centered integrated care continuum for cardiovascular and neurological conditions. In this stepped wedge randomized trial, investigators plan to implement and evaluate the use of the BRILLIANT Platform for improving transitions of care in the rehabilitation of ABI individuals in Quebec.
Methods: A stepped wedge cluster randomized trial will be conducted across four healthcare regions with eight programs. Eligible participants included new cardiovascular and neurological patients, caregivers, clinicians, coordinators, and managers. The BRILLIANT platform intervention, implemented in 2 phases, will provide standardized assessments, communication tools, shared intervention plans, self-management support, and quality improvement dashboards. Outcomes will include rehabilitation intensity measured in minutes, time from admission to rehabilitation, health-related quality of life, care experience, and costs. Data analysis will use mixed-effects models for quantitative data and content analysis for qualitative data.
Discussion: This study will provide valuable evidence on the effectiveness and feasibility of the BRILLIANT platform in improving rehabilitation care for patients with cardiovascular and neurological conditions in Quebec. Investigators anticipate that by addressing the challenges and pursuing future directions, the implementation of this digital platform can contribute to improving patient outcomes and healthcare delivery.

Research questions and sites The research questions guiding this study are: 1) What are the potential barriers and facilitators in the implementation of the BRILLIANT platform at the local teams' level?; 2) What is the impact of the BRILLIANT platform compared to usual cardiovascular and neurological care on the primary outcome, intensity of rehabilitation (direct minutes of rehabilitation per week); 3) Does the platform have an impact on secondary outcomes: time to be admitted to rehabilitation (inpatient or outpatient), health-related quality of life, care experience, and if found to be effective, costs?; 4) What are the implementation factors that explain potential impact (e.g., relevance, acceptability)? An integrated knowledge translation (iKT) approach will be used by involving all relevant partners throughout the research process. The partners are stakeholders within four health regions with two to four programs each in various rehabilitation stages for cardiovascular and neurological care in Quebec. In four health regions and 8 cardiovascular and neurological programs, this implementation study follows two phases aiming answering the 4 research questions.
Study phases and procedures Phase I is for measuring and addressing the potential barriers and facilitators related to the implementation of the BRILLIANT platform and prepare teams for implementation. With each program investigators will review the workflow (clinical processes and the material and human resources available) for cardiovascular and neurological care pathways, and use the Business Process Model and Notation (BPMN) method and analyze them to maximize successful implementation during the trial. The purpose of this first phase is to determine what the BRILLIANT platform will look like. Through focus groups with 8-10 participants per program comprised of all health professions, coordinators, managers, and patient/family participants with experience with different phases of the rehabilitation process. In the focus groups, investigators will review how the platform will work, validate certain tasks, and ensure ease of use so that investigators may adjust as needed. Identifying barriers and facilitators to implementing the platform during the focus groups will be guided by the Consolidated Framework for Implementation Research (CFIR). Focus group sessions will be recorded and transcribed, and further analysed to feed back information on barriers and facilitators during subsequent design workshops to also inform adaptation and implementation of the platform.
The second phase is to evaluate the impact of the BRILLIANT platform on primary (intensity of rehabilitation, i.e. direct minutes of rehabilitation per week), and secondary outcomes (time to be admitted to inpatient or outpatient rehabilitation, health-related quality of life, care experience, and costs if the platform is found to have an impact) and evaluating the factors that impact implementation. The control condition will be usual care, which consists of an interdisciplinary team of physiotherapy, occupational therapy, nursing, medicine, psychology, speech therapy, social work, and nutrition. Clinicians mostly work on paper evaluating patient needs (mostly by checklist) using static standardized forms (e.g., Functional Independence Measure, FIM, at admission) without reminders, scoring and interactive functionalities. The choice of standardized assessment is left to the discretion of each clinician. Since the pandemic Microsoft teams is used to share scanned documents between clinicians and remote program meetings. During the control period clinicians will have access to static forms on the BRILLIANT Platform.
Intervention details The intervention will be the use of the BRILLIANT Platform. The platform provides five Modules aimed at increasing coordination of care and direct rehabilitation time (Table 1): 1) Standardized measures: provided consistently with scoring and reminders to complete assessments, across all stages of recovery and care settings to guide and evaluate treatment effectiveness of clinical outcomes (e.g. FIM, Mayo Portland Adaptability Inventory - MPAI), performance based outcomes (e.g. gait speed), patient reported outcome measures (e.g. pain level during walking); 2) Communication Module: clinicians can communicate together and with patient/family to clarify patient-related information (e.g. safety concerns, intervention plan progression) and update colleagues for time sensitive information, synchronously (scheduled tele-videoconference) and asynchronously; 3) Shared intervention goals and plan: personalized and dynamic care trajectory and intervention plan guided by standardized assessments, reminders, and evidence-based interventions recommendations to direct patients and caregivers to the right services and interventions (e.g. treadmill walking practice) at the right time based on clinical and social profile and best practices;1,2 4) Self-management support: To provide patients and families with self-management dashboards (e.g. physical activity tracking and reminders) and interactive online intervention plan (goals, action plan, monitoring progress) to actively engage the patient and family in setting goals with their care team. Access to evidence-based patient education and resource modules, tailored to stage of recovery (e.g. Education on how to handle arm or shoulder); 5) Quality Improvement Dashboards to provide feedback and reports allowing observation of clinical/administrative/clinical performance indicators (based on MSSS indicators, Quadruple Aim framework) for continuous program evaluation.
Each health region will be provided with cloud-based access to the platform as agreed in collaboration with their IT units. Each site will have support from a knowledge broker from the research team to promote the platform's purpose, features and benefits and build understanding, and engagement of the local programs. Pre-implementation, there will be: 1) a 2-hour training session (respecting COVID restrictions) in each site and an online training video that participants can access anytime; 2) a platform guidebook explaining each functionality, that can be accessed anytime.

The intensity of rehabilitation
时间窗: 27 months
The intensity of rehabilitation (direct minutes of rehabilitation per week) will be calculated for all new patients seen during the control and intervention period using data from SIPAD64 (Système d'information pour les personnes ayant une déficience), that will be obtained from the directorate of professional services (DPS) administrative database where clinicians record the direct and indirect time spent with patients and caregivers.
